Description

View of Saint Étienne Cathedral in Toulouse, with its imposing bell tower and Gothic facade adorned with a rose window. In the foreground, pedestrians and horse-drawn vehicles on a paved square. Reverse: handwritten text describing the history of the building, mentioning its nave built in 1130, its choir completed in 1609, and its forged gates from 1771.
